Ionospheric response to the space weather events during December 2006 in the South<br />

Pacific Region<br />

Kumar Sushil , Kumar Abhikesh<br />

School of Engineering <strong>an</strong>d Physics, The University of the South Pacific, Suva, Fiji<br />

We study the VLF perturbations on subionospheric signals from NWC (19.8 kHz), NPM<br />

(21.4 kHz), VTX3 (18.2 kHz), NLK (24.8 kHz) VLF tr<strong>an</strong>smitters monitored at Suva, Fiji,<br />

due to solar flares that occurred during 5-14 December 2006. A series of solar flares with<br />

classes from C1.7 to X9.0 occurred during 5-14 December that produced VLF perturbations<br />

on above VLF signals. An intense storm associated with coronal mass ejections <strong>an</strong>d solar<br />

flares of X class occurred at 14:14 UT on 14 December with a minimum Dst value of -145 nT<br />

at 0800 hrs on 15 December. A solar flare of class X1.5 occurred on 14 December 2006 at<br />

21:07 UT <strong>an</strong>d ended at 22:26 UT with its peak flux at 22:15 UT, during the main phase onset<br />

of this storm. Enh<strong>an</strong>cements in the amplitude (DA) of above VLF tr<strong>an</strong>smissions were<br />

determined. The values of DA were found to be in the r<strong>an</strong>ge of 3.6 - 8.8 dB for solar flares of<br />

C1.7 to X9.0 classes.The enh<strong>an</strong>cement in the amplitudes of VLF signals is due to the increase<br />

in the D-region electron density due to ionization enh<strong>an</strong>cements produced by the solar flares.<br />

An intense storm associated with coronal mass ejections <strong>an</strong>d solar flares of X class occurred<br />

at 14:14 UT on 14 December with a minimum Dst value of -145 nT at 0800 hrs UT on 15<br />

December. The storm-time effects in the F2-region during at Niue (19.06.2 o S, 169.93 o W) <strong>an</strong>d<br />

Townville (19.63 o S, 146.85 o E), low latitude stations near at the ionization <strong>an</strong>omaly crest, will<br />

be presented.
